Q: Is 120,083,121 a Composite Number?

 A: Yes, 120,083,121 is a composite number.

Why is 120,083,121 a composite number?

A composite number is a number that can be divided evenly by more numbers than 1 and itself. It is the opposite of a prime number.

The number 120,083,121 can be evenly divided by 1 3 9 17 27 51 153 459 261,619 784,857 2,354,571 4,447,523 7,063,713 13,342,569 40,027,707 and 120,083,121, with no remainder.

Since 120,083,121 cannot be divided by just 1 and 120,083,121, it is a composite number.
